Ibrahim al-Koni

Ibrahim al -Koni ( * 1948 in Ghadames in Libya) is a Libyan writer.

Life

In the 1970s, al -Koni went to Moscow and studied literature at the Maxim Gorky Literature Institute. In 1993 he moved to Switzerland.

Works

Al- Koni works are mainly centered around the concept of " home" and connect old narrative forms with the modern novel. In The Magician. The epic of the Tuareg he describes the problems between nomads and sedentary people.
